摘 要:目的:观察大鼠前庭神经核群向动眼神经核的投射纤维特征。方法:实验于1997年在青岛大学医学院解剖教研室实验室进行。选择6~8周龄SD大鼠20只,将辣根过氧化物酶注射到大鼠的动眼神经核,其中5只注射0.01μL其余15只注射0.05μL。经过48h的逆行轴突运输后用组织化学的方法在脑干中显示被标记的神经元。按实际注射结果将20只大鼠分为6组:①辣根过氧化酶注射到动眼神经核的外侧,没有累及动眼神经核及内侧纵束。②注射到动眼神经核的外部累及内侧纵束和动眼神经核的少部分。③注射部分靠近中线影响双侧动眼神经核。④注射部位在动眼神经核的背侧,没有影响动眼神经核的腹侧。⑤以动眼神经核为中心辣根过氧化物酶的吸收区在它的边界以外。⑥注射部位在动眼神经核胞体部分的中心,推测有效吸收区完全在动眼神经核胞体部分边界内。观察各组及不同剂量的实验动物的标记细胞分布和神经纤维走行。结果:20只大鼠进入结果分析。前庭神经上核、内侧核、下核、外侧核及Y核、膝上核和膝旁核都有标记细胞。上核在前庭神经核的最吻端,主要在同侧标记,多数为中小型细胞;内侧核、下核双侧标记,但以对侧标记为主,两核吻侧形成一体,内侧核标记细胞密集,由中小型神经元组成,下核标记细胞稍大,比较分散;外侧核双侧有少量标记标记细胞;膝上核、膝旁核在注射对侧有明显的标记细胞,并同展神经核核间神经元相连续,环绕面膝形成庞大的神经纤维束进入对侧内侧纵束,在展神经核尾侧200μm仍可以看到前庭神经核群发出的交叉纤维。结论:大鼠前庭神经核发出纤维投向动眼神经核,前庭神经内侧核、部分前庭神经下核主要投射向动眼神经核内直肌亚核,推测这部分纤维和双眼协同运动有关。AIM: To observe the characteristics of projection fibers from vestibular nucleus to oculomotor nucleus (OMN) in rats. METHODS: The experiment was conducted in the laboratory of Anatomy, Medical College of Qingdao University in 1997. Twenty SD rats aged 6-8 weeks old were selected, The horseradish peroxidase (HRP) was injected into the OMN of rats, 5 of which were injected of 0.01 μL, and the other 15 ones were injected of 0.05 μL. After 48-hour of retrograde axonal transport, the labeled cells in brain stem were demonstrated with histochemical method, and 20 rats were divided into 6 groups according to the actual injection results:①The OMN and medial longitudinal fasciculus were not involved by the injection of HRP in the extra-lateral of OMN. ②Injection in exterior OMN affected little parts of medial longitudinal fasciculus and OMN.③Injection near the median line affected bilateral OMN.④Injection on the dorsal parts of OMN did not affect the ventral parts of OMN. ⑤The absorption area of HRP was outside the boundary of OMN. ⑥Injection in OMN cell body centers, and it was assumed that the effective absorption area was completely inside the OMN boundary. The distribution of labeled cells and the nerve fiber trend of experimental animals in all groups at different dose were observed. RESULTS: A total of 20 rats were involved in the analysis of results. The labeled cells could be seen in superior vestibular nucleus, medial vestibular nucleus, inferior nucleus, lateral nucleus, cell group Y , supergenual nucleus and paragenual nucleus. The superior nucleus was in the rostral side of vestibular nucleus,which was mainly labeled ipsilaterally, and most of them were middle and small cells. The labeled cells clustered densely in medial nucleus, which was constituted of middle and small neurons. The labeled cells of inferior nucleus were slightly bigger and scattered.
